Weather not a factor in OSU plane crash

Weather was not a factor in the plane crash that killed Oklahoma State women’s basketball coach Kurt Budke and assistant Miranda Serna.

An investigator for the National Transportation Safety Board said Saturday that winds were calm and skies were clear when the plane carrying Budke and Serna crashed Thursday night in central Arkansas.

The NTSB said that it could take nine months to a year to determine the cause of the crash.

The plane crash comes 10 months after the school commemorated the 10th anniversary of a crash that killed 10 men associated with the men’s program.
